When it comes to financing your property investment, there are several options to consider. The most common type of loan used for property investment is a mortgage. A mortgage is a loan specifically designed for purchasing a property, whether it be a single-family home, multi-unit property, or commercial real estate. Mortgages typically have lower interest rates compared to other types of loans, making them an attractive option for investors.
Another popular loan option for property investment is a home equity loan or line of credit. If you already own a property with equity built up, you can use that equity as collateral to secure a loan for your new investment property. Home equity loans typically have higher interest rates than mortgages but can be a good option for investors who need access to cash quickly.
For investors looking to purchase a fixer-upper or distressed property, a renovation loan may be the best option. Renovation loans are specifically designed to cover the cost of purchasing a property and making necessary repairs and upgrades. These loans can be a great way to increase the value of your investment property and generate higher rental income or resale value.
Investors who want to purchase multiple properties may benefit from a portfolio loan. Portfolio loans are designed for investors who own multiple properties and need financing for their real estate portfolio. These loans often have more flexible terms and higher interest rates compared to traditional mortgages, but they can be a good option for experienced investors with a proven track record.
One of the newest trends in property investment financing is peer-to-peer lending. Peer-to-peer lending platforms connect individual investors with borrowers looking for financing. These platforms offer competitive interest rates and flexible terms, making them a popular choice for investors who may not qualify for traditional bank loans. Peer-to-peer lending can be a great way to diversify your financing options and access capital quickly.
